The application provides a recording circuit control board and a recording device, wherein the recording circuit control board comprises a printed circuit board body, a main control chip, a storage chip, a power management unit and a microphone array arranged on the printed circuit board body, the power management unit, the main control chip and the storage chip are arranged along the long side direction of the printed circuit board body; the microphone array is arranged on the side of the printed circuit board body provided with the main control chip and is distributed on the two side long sides of the printed circuit board body; wherein only one microphone is arranged on the first side long side of the microphone array, a plurality of microphones are arranged on the second side long side, and the center line of the center of the microphone on the first side long side and the center of the microphone at the two ends on the second side long side forms an isosceles triangle. According to the arrangement mode of the microphone array and the audio algorithm in the main control chip, the environmental noise in the sound information can be reduced, and the classification pickup of the sound is beneficial.

[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of circuit control board, in particular to a recording circuit control board and a recording device. BACKGROUND

[0002] With the development of modern science and technology, digital products have evolved from the initial bulky large computers to small devices that can be worn on the body. Among them, wearable recording devices have emerged as the times require. They can accompany users in their daily activities and are widely used.

[0003] Traditional recording devices receive sound information from the external environment and identify and record the sound information from the external environment. However, with the rapid development of electronic information technology, traditional recording devices have been difficult to adapt to today's booming intelligent development. The existing recording devices are based on traditional analog sound collection and perform remote and dispersed sound processing. In this way, there is too much environmental noise in the sound information, which is not conducive to the classification and picking up of sound. SUMMARY

[0040] Please refer to Figure 1 , Figure 1 The first recording circuit control board provided by the embodiment of the present application is shown in the structural schematic diagram of Figure 1As shown in the embodiment, the recording circuit control board comprises a printed circuit board body 1, a main control chip 2, a storage chip 3, a power management unit 4 and a microphone array arranged on the printed circuit board body 1, the power management unit 4, the main control chip 2 and the storage chip 3 are arranged along the long side direction of the printed circuit board body 1; the power management unit 4 is used for power supply, the main control chip 2 internally stores a DSP audio algorithm, which is used for operation and processing of the picked-up sound, and the storage chip 3 is used for storing the audio track file processed by the main control chip 2.

[0041] The microphone array is arranged on one side of the printed circuit board body 1 provided with the main control chip 2 and is distributed on the two side long sides of the printed circuit board body 1; wherein only one microphone is arranged on the first side long side of the microphone array, and a plurality of microphones are arranged on the second side long side, and the center line of the center of the microphone on the first side long side and the center of the microphone at the two ends on the second side long side forms an isosceles triangle.

[0042] Specifically, according to the arrangement mode of the microphone array and in combination with the audio algorithm in the main control chip 2, the microphone on the first side long side and the microphone on the second side long side simultaneously pick up sound, the picked-up sound is processed by the audio algorithm in the main control chip 2, so that the microphone on the first side long side is mainly used for picking up sound, the microphone on the second side long side is mainly used for shielding noise, and the noise in the surrounding environment is eliminated, and finally two clear audio track files are obtained and saved in the storage chip 3.

[0043] Optionally, the process of processing the sound signal by the main control chip 2 can comprise: respectively performing sound algorithm operation, data scheduling transmission, peripheral device cooperative logic control and interactive management of system application on the digital audio signal. Optionally, before processing the above-mentioned digital audio signal, the main control chip 2 can first perform noise reduction processing on the received digital audio signal based on a noise reduction algorithm.

[0044] In this scheme, when the user needs to record the conversation between himself and others, the chest card type recording device can be used for recording, the microphone array on the recording circuit control board picks up the sound information of the outside world, and then the DSP algorithm on the main control chip 2 is used for data processing, so that the picked-up sound information is divided into two audio track files and saved in the storage chip 3, and finally the device can transmit the audio track file saved in the storage chip 3 to the collection station through the USB interface or Bluetooth for data storage and uploading.

[0045] Preferably, the microphone array comprises a first omnidirectional microphone 51, a second omnidirectional microphone 52, a third omnidirectional microphone 53 and a fourth omnidirectional microphone 54.

[0046] The first omnidirectional microphone 51 is centrally arranged on the first side long edge of the printed circuit board body 1, the second omnidirectional microphone 52, the third omnidirectional microphone 53 and the fourth omnidirectional microphone 54 are sequentially arranged on the second side long edge of the printed circuit board body 1, and the center of the second omnidirectional microphone 52, the center of the third omnidirectional microphone 53 and the center of the fourth omnidirectional microphone 54 are collinear;

[0047] The line connecting the center of the first omnidirectional microphone 51 and the center of the third omnidirectional microphone 53 is perpendicular to the line connecting the center of the second omnidirectional microphone 52 and the center of the fourth omnidirectional microphone 54.

[0048] Preferably, the center distance between the first omnidirectional microphone 51 and the third omnidirectional microphone 53, the center distance between the second omnidirectional microphone 52 and the third omnidirectional microphone 53, and the center distance between the third omnidirectional microphone 53 and the fourth omnidirectional microphone 54 are all between 20mm and 40mm.

[0049] In this scheme, the optimal center distance between the first omnidirectional microphone 51 and the third omnidirectional microphone 53, the optimal center distance between the second omnidirectional microphone 52 and the third omnidirectional microphone 53, and the optimal center distance between the third omnidirectional microphone 53 and the fourth omnidirectional microphone 54 are all 20mm. According to the position of the omnidirectional microphone and the center distance between the adjacent two omnidirectional microphones, the algorithm running in the main control chip 2 is designed and stored in the main control chip 2, and then the sound picked up by each omnidirectional microphone is transmitted to the main control chip 2 for operation and processing, so that a sound file with better fidelity can be obtained.

[0050] Please refer to Figure 2 , Figure 2 The first recording circuit control board structure connection schematic diagram provided by the embodiment of the application; as shown in Figure 2 The four omnidirectional microphones simultaneously pick up the surrounding sound, and then transmit the sound to the main control chip 2, and the picked-up sound is operated and processed by the DSP audio algorithm in the main control chip 2. The processed sound is divided into two sound tracks, including a first separated sound track and a second separated sound track. The first separated sound track is the sound file of the user, and the second separated sound track is the sound file of the surrounding people. The sound files of the first separated sound track and the second separated sound track are saved in the storage chip 3 respectively.

[0051] Specifically, the omnidirectional microphone of the present application can be a silicon microphone, which can also be referred to as a micro-electromechanical system microphone (MEMS microphone) or a microphone chip. The silicon microphone has the advantages of high sensitivity, consistent phase, good stability, small size, etc. The sound data collected by the silicon microphone is conducive to the accurate positioning of the sound source by the main control chip 2 and the calculation of narrow beams based on the principle of beamforming, so as to achieve the function of noise reduction. In addition, the sampling rate of the silicon microphone is usually greater than or equal to 16k / 24bit. By using this sampling rate and combining with the algorithms of accurate sound source positioning, narrow beam noise reduction, and echo cancellation, the quality of the recording data output by the main control chip 2 is higher, and the accuracy is higher when the recording data is used for subsequent sound recognition and text transcription. In addition, the sound collecting distance of the silicon microphone can usually reach 5-8 meters, so that the chest card type recording device can more accurately collect sound data at close range.

[0054] The combined microphone array comprises a fifth omnidirectional microphone 61, a sixth omnidirectional microphone 62, and a directional microphone 63. The fifth omnidirectional microphone 61 and the sixth omnidirectional microphone 62 are arranged on the second long side of the printed circuit board body 1. The fifth omnidirectional microphone 61 is adjacent to the third omnidirectional microphone 53, and the sixth omnidirectional microphone 62 is adjacent to the fourth omnidirectional microphone 54.

[0055] The directional microphone 63 is located on the first long side of the printed circuit board body 1 and is arranged at the corner of the printed circuit board body 1 close to the power management unit 4.

[0056] The directional microphone 63, also known as a super-directional microphone, can only pick up sound in a single direction, and its sensitivity to sound data in the direction of sound pickup is higher than that of sound data in other directions.

[0057] ​The recording circuit control board provided in the embodiment of the present application can collect close-range sound data through the omnidirectional microphones in the microphone array, and the close-range sound data can be used for noise reduction, so that the main control chip 2 processes the close-range sound data collected by the microphone array, and the recording data obtained has higher accuracy when performing subsequent sound recognition and text transcription. In addition, the recording circuit control board provided in the embodiment of the present application can also collect long-range sound data through the directional microphone 63 in the microphone array, and since the directional microphone 63 has a higher sampling rate, the processing circuit processes the long-range sound data collected by the directional microphone 63, and the recording data obtained has higher fidelity and can clearly restore the recording scene, and the obtained recording data has better listening experience. Therefore, the recording circuit control board provided in the embodiment of the present application improves the sound collection effect of the recording equipment using the recording circuit control board by arranging the microphone array.

[0058] Please refer to Figure 4 , Figure 4 The second recording circuit control board provided in the embodiment of the present application is shown in the structure connection schematic diagram. Figure 4 The directional microphone 63 picks up long-range sound signals, and the two omnidirectional microphones pick up close-range sound signals. The picked-up sound signals are all transmitted to the main control chip 2, and the picked-up sound is processed through the DSP audio algorithm in the main control chip 2, and then two sound track files are obtained, including a third separated sound track and a fourth separated sound track. The third separated sound track represents a close-range sound file, that is, a user's sound file, and the fourth separated sound track represents a long-range sound file, that is, a sound file of a person around. The third separated sound track and the fourth separated sound track are transmitted to the storage chip 3 and saved respectively.

[0059] Preferably, the center distance between the fifth omnidirectional microphone 61 and the sixth omnidirectional microphone 62 is between 20mm and 40mm; and the center line of the directional microphone 63 is perpendicular to the printed circuit board body 1.

[0060] In the embodiment of the present application, the optimal center distance between the fifth omnidirectional microphone 61 and the sixth omnidirectional microphone 62 is 20mm. The directional microphone 63 needs to have directivity, and the pickup direction needs to be perpendicular to the printed circuit board body 1 and combined with the omnidirectional microphone. When the pickup angle of the directional microphone 63 is upward, the sound intensity picked up within 60 degrees of the forward direction of the microphone opening is greater than the sound intensity picked up outside 60 degrees by more than 6db, and then combined with the beamforming algorithm simulation processing, the sound intensity picked up within 60 degrees is greater than the sound intensity picked up outside 60 degrees by more than 10db.

[0061] Specifically, the above-mentioned directional microphone can be an electret microphone (ECM). The electret microphone here has the advantages of high precision and low price. The sampling rate of the electret microphone is higher than that of the silicon microphone. Usually, the sampling rate of the electret microphone is greater than or equal to 96k / 24bit. By adopting this sampling rate and combining it with the noise reduction algorithm, the recording data output by the main control chip 2 has higher fidelity, thereby restoring a more realistic and clear recording scene, and the obtained recording data has a better listening experience. In addition, the sound receiving distance of the electret microphone can reach more than 15 meters, so that the badge-type recording equipment can more accurately collect sound data from a long distance.

[0062] In the embodiment of the present application, the microphone array and the combined microphone array are integrated on a printed circuit board body 1, and further, a dip switch 7 is provided on the second long side and near the power management unit 4;

[0063] When the dial switch 7 is in the first position, the recording circuit control board uses the microphone array to work; when the dial switch 7 is in the second position, the recording circuit control board uses the combined microphone array to work.

[0064] In this way, the recording circuit control board can be controlled by controlling the DIP switch 7 to control which recording mode to use. In addition, there is also a third position. When the DIP switch 7 is in the third position, the recording circuit control board uses the microphone array and the combined microphone array to work simultaneously.
